About the Role

Baker Hughes is seeking a Project Controller - Finance to join their team in Dhahran, Saudi Arabia. This full-time position involves providing financial planning, analysis, and reporting for corporate functions, business units, or profit and loss centers to ensure projects align with approved budgets and financial objectives. The Finance Team at Baker Hughes supports business operations through worldwide book closings and collaboration with local and regional controllership teams, handling preparatory and closing activities including reporting and intercompany transactions.

Key Responsibilities

  • Oversee project execution and management, ensuring adherence to approved budgets in collaboration with the Project Manager.
  • Proactively manage financial and accounting matters, implementing actions to improve controls and reporting accuracy.
  • Ensure consistent and accurate reporting and forecasting of revenue, costs, progress, schedules, and contingencies.
  • Apply foundational knowledge of engineering, drilling, supply chain, HR, and P&L operations to accurately estimate revenue, fixed and variable costs, activity rates, and indirect costs.
  • Develop and maintain strong working relationships with project teams, leading financial discussions.
  • Assist the Project Manager with project closure activities and prepare financial documentation for after-action reviews.
  • Develop actionable plans to address unfavorable variances, mitigate risks, and improve project profitability and cash flow.

Qualifications and Requirements

  • A Bachelor's degree in Finance or Accounting, or an equivalent qualification from an accredited university or college.
  • A minimum of 10 years of experience in finance.
  • At least 3 years of experience specifically in Financial Planning and Analysis (FP&A) Operations, such as a Finance Manager role.
  • Previous experience in the oil & gas industry is preferred.
  • Demonstrated ability to analyze and resolve complex financial problems.
  • Proven ability to lead programs and projects effectively.
